Introduction
Bank reconciliation is one of the most tedious yet critical processes in accounting. Matching bank transactions with accounting records manually can take hours and still be prone to errors. Fortunately, AI tools can now automate this entire workflow—saving time, improving accuracy, and offering real-time insights.
What Can Be Automated?
- Auto-importing transactions from bank feeds
- Matching deposits and expenses with ledger entries
- Flagging mismatches and anomalies
- Auto-categorizing unmatched entries
- Reconciliation reporting and audit trails
Ready-to-Use Prompts
Use these prompts with AI tools or chat interfaces that support automation (e.g., ChatGPT + Zapier + QuickBooks):
📌 Match Bank Transactions
Match all incoming bank transactions from Chase Bank for the past 30 days with expenses in QuickBooks. Flag any mismatches.
📌 Categorize Unmatched Items
Categorize unmatched transactions based on past behavior and vendor type. Tag with appropriate expense accounts.
📌 Reconciliation Report
Generate a reconciliation report for the month of April 2025 and email it to the finance team.
Best Practices
- Set up rules to auto-match recurring transactions (e.g., subscriptions).
- Regularly review flagged items to keep training the AI.
- Back up reports monthly for audit readiness.
- Maintain access control to limit sensitive banking permissions.
Final Thoughts
AI can reconcile up to 95% of bank transactions with little human input. With tools like QuickBooks and Xero, even small businesses can benefit from intelligent automation. Start small, set rules, and let the AI improve over time.